Cannonball Cottage

This is a lovingly refinished 1915-era folk Victorian rescued from demolition and relocated to the banks of the Cannonball River in Mott, N.D., near the Badlands, Black Hills and agrarian prairie country. The porch is great for watching sunsets, wildlife, fish jumping in the river below and the occasional prairie thunderstorm rolling in. Stars like you won’t believe. The interior is a mix of arty eclectic and 50’s retro. I love this cottage. You will too. Kitchen ware, towels, bedding provided.
